I will be raising money for two charities who come under the same umbrella.

Families Fighting For Justice is a charity created by Jean Taylor who has also lost family members to murder. It provides vital support to families of murder, manslaughter and culpable road death victims.

Also, Our Lost Love Years (OLLY) was created by Joseph, a young boy who lost his mother to murder.

OLLY provides children and young people who have suffered the loss of a loved one through acts of violence and also children from communities across merseyside with support and a range of activities designed at helping them to re-gain the fun in their lives and help them re-establish and make friendships following their traumatic experiences.
